The Thieaudio Legacy 3 was designed to provide an affordable in-ear monitor that would take no cuts in build or audio quality. While the Legacy 3 is an entry model into the Legacy series, its sound is the culmination of all of our skills and knowledge until now, and it falls nothing short of top of its class. In approaching the tuning of the Legacy 3, it had to be balanced and audiophile-grade in order to meet the Legacy series’ standards
The proprietary 10mm Nano-Membrane dynamic diaphragm driver used in the Legacy 3 is the same high-quality driver as that of its older brother, the Legacy 9. The result is a coherent treble response that extends far, retrieves every detail, yet lacks any unnecessary dips or peaks. The resulting tuning is extremely balanced, with a powerful bass, slightly warm but clean mids, and detailed, yet coherent trebles. We could not be more proud of the Legacy 3’s sound, and for this reason, we believe it is a solid foundation for the Legacy lineup.
For the Legacy 3, we decided to go with a custom mechanical watch faceplate design. Each Legacy 3 is hand built from medical grade resin, and actual watch components are arranged by hand on the faceplate, before being sealed with resin. The result is an extremely detailed and elegant look, one that is different for every Legacy 3. Each earpiece takes almost an entire day to build, and the outcome is something that no mass produced product can ever achieve
The Legacy 3 was paired with a custom 7N 8-core OCC copper cable made specifically for the Legacy 3. We chose copper as it emphasizes the smooth and warm characteristic of the IEM, bringing to life the detail and texture within the sound. You won’t have to worry about buying any other cable for the Legacy 3.

We, who are in this hobby, buy many iems to find the perfect one to our liking. Legacy 3 will be one of those perfect ones for a lot of people. The cohesive musicality is spectacular, especially for a hybrid iem at this price range. The sound signature is balanced with a hint of warmth to it. The presentation of music is from a distance to your brain, as a result, this is a relaxing iem to listen to.
Imaging is great; every instrument has their designated space. Soundstage is average for the price point, neither special nor lacking. Instrument separation is very admirable too, but you’ll definitely realize the detail retrieval is not strong enough to compliment that properly. If you are sensitive to treble, this iem is a god given gift to you. It just sounds right in the treble section. What I mean is you won’t miss any treble detail. But, they are not fatiguing or harsh to listen to. The mids are just so smooth and forgiving. I listen to 70s/80s band a lot. A mix of distorted guitar and often poorly recorded albums. Many iems fail to capture the soul of this genre as they often times focuses on the wrong things, and makes them sound lifeless/harsh/hollow/tiny. But, not the Legacy 3. They are your perfect head-banging iem. The guitar notes are thick and the male vocals are lively. In the low region, it’s a star of a performer. Many have praised them, I will too. The sub bass is good. The transition to mid bass is well done. The bass is tastefully done to a level that even bass head might like them.
Cons: Cable is rubbery and microphonic. The notch in the iem shell may cause discomfort to you depending on your ear shape - they are made to be universal, but this type of notch design is certainly not perfect for everyone, you might get unlucky. People who like bright iems, will not find this iem to their liking. Not for monitoring, as it lacks micro details.
Overall: A great musical iem from Thieaudio. If you like warm smooth sound signature, it's a no brainer. A good side upgrade to famous Shure SE215 with similar sound but slightly better in almost every aspect.

I got my pair late April, 2020. Recently, I picked up another pair during 11.11 because I love them that much (and because the old one is falling apart, slowly).
My 1st pair is a sub-100 serial # unit, and it's plagued with problems.
1) the dip switch are just for gimmicks. The 1st switch doesn't do anything, while the 2nd cuts down bass and treble by 1 dB or so. Absolutely unlike the graph published by BGGAR on his unit, and subsequent graphs made by others confirm this.
2) very loose 2-pin connectors. They always manage to get loose and fall off of my ears onto the floor randomly. As a result, both the raised connector shield on both ear pieces have cracked and chipped off. That said, the cable can still be connected, and the IEM works fine even after 5-6 waist-height drops.
Sound-wise, the L3 is neutral with boosted bass for my ears. It could use some more treble though. Bass is quite slow, muddying up and lacking detail. However, it has weight, and it gives the guitar on metal tracks the intensity the genre demands. If anything, I want an L3 sound with a more capable DD. Other than that, I might've just found my preferred sound signature thanks to the L3.
It's so inoffensive while being plenty of fun. The only drawback being the 'meh' DD.
Now, the new pair I just bought. Out of the box, they sound completely identical to my 9-month old (heavily used pair) both using stock tips. I thought they might need burn in, but it was unnecessary. It seems that the loose connection issue has been addressed, but the dip switches are still there for show.
